I am after a fast growing moss (not Java) or plant that will creep

This is what I want it for I have a large bit of hollow wood in my tank which is placed vertical I would like to place a bit of moss or a plant at the bottom of the wood and it would creep up the side of the wood.
 
I have just ordered a 5x5cm pad of it will give it a try

is there any other plant that would do it ?
 
There is no such thing as fast growing moss. Some mosses may grow faster than others but they are not fast growing compared to other plants.

So whats the fastest of the mosses then ?
 
As Darrel mentions, Xmas is one of the faster types, and so is Spiky and Weeping. Naturally, adding massive levels of CO2 and with stronger lighting will accelerate the growth rates.

Cheers,
 
Willow moss is quick growing, although it had quite an upright form and I don't think it would cling to the wood.
